A member asked:

Fall on left wrist, horendous pain, minor-major swelling, heat around the swelling, bruising?

2 doctors weighed in across 2 answers

Might be broken: A fall on an outstretched hand is an easy way to get a torus or buckle fracture in the wrist. It's easy to treat, and rarely results in any complications, but you'll need an xray to see.
